Volatility and RTP: What the Numbers Actually Mean

Volatility tells you how often a pokie pays out and how big those payouts are. Low volatility means frequent small wins. High volatility means rare but larger wins. Medium volatility sits somewhere in between. For e-wallet players who want to stretch their bankroll, low to medium volatility is usually the better choice. You get more playtime, and the risk of losing your entire deposit in 10 minutes is lower.

RTP, or return to player, is the theoretical percentage of all wagered money that a pokie will pay back over time. A pokie with 96% RTP will return $96 for every $100 wagered, on average. That is the long-term figure. In the short term, anything can happen. That is why we recommend playing pokies with an RTP of 96% or higher. Anything below 94% is not worth your time.

Responsible Gambling and BetStop

Every Aussie player should be aware of BetStop, the national self-exclusion scheme. It allows you to exclude yourself from all licensed online casinos in Australia. The process is simple. You register on the BetStop website, choose your exclusion period, and that is it. All participating casinos will block your account. It is a powerful tool for anyone who feels their gambling is getting out of hand.

Gambling Help Online (1800 858) is another resource. The counsellors are trained to help with gambling-related issues. The service is free and confidential. No one should ever feel ashamed to reach out. Gambling is meant to be entertainment, not a source of stress.

We also recommend setting deposit limits before you start playing. Most casinos allow you to set daily, weekly, or monthly limits. Use them. It is a simple way to stay in control. And if you ever feel like you are chasing losses, take a break. The pokies will still be there tomorrow.
